We just had a story on the news about some mother bitching about some brawl that occurred on the weekend in the AFL (The highlight of the story was someone who was perhaps seven saying that the violence was 'horrid', a fine example of media coached children).
This is one of my major pet peeves, violence, while not nice (or PC), is part of sports like this, yet all these soccer mums decide that it's not right for their children to see this, this is the part that gets me, the idea that athletes are supposed to be role models and the such, it never occurred to anyone that violence and sports like this go hand in hand?

What are your thoughts on the subject?
